Documenting a Performing Arts History

Thursday, September 14, 2023, 6:00PM

NYUAD Campus, Conference Center

Past Event

Open to the Public

Key figures involved in The Arts Center’s creation explore the significance and meaning of arts documentation while reflecting on their collaborative journey capturing seven years of The Arts Center’s history. They offer unique perspectives on their approaches and their individual and collective contributions toward this effort.
